2 tablespoons Canola or other vegetable oil
1 large onion, chopped
1 celery stalk, finely chopped
2 minced garlic or 1/4 teaspoon garlic powder
3 white or whole wheat bread slices or equal amount of seasoned bread crumbs
2 pounds lean ground beef or turkey or pork or mixture of all
1 medium carrot, finely shredded
8 oz Monterey Jack cheese, shredded
1-1/2 teaspoons salt
1/4 teaspoon ground red cayenne pepper
1/2 teaspoon oregano
1 egg, beaten
8 oz can tomato sauce
1 tablespoons light brown sugar
1 tablespoons cider vinegar
1 tablespoon prepared mustard
serves 8
In large saucepan over medium heat, heat oil. To hot oil add the chopped onion and celery. Cook about 8 minutes, stirring occasionally. Add garlic, cook another 2 minutes. Into a food processor or blender, put in bread slices and process to coarse crumbs. (If using ground turkey, I use only 2 slices of bread.) In large bowl add onion, celery, garlic mixture to bread crumbs and mix well. To the bread and onion mixture add 6 oz of the cheddar cheese., ground meat, shredded carrot, salt, pepper, oregano, egg, brown sugar, vinegar, mustard, and half of the tomato sauce. Mix thoroughly. (hands do it best). In a 12×8 inch baking dish or loaf pan, with hands shape ground beef mixture into loaf shape, about 8×4 inches. Set aside. Sprinkle remaining cheddar cheese over top. Spoon over remaining tomato sauce on top of meat loaf. Bake in 350 deg F. oven for 1-1/2 hours. Serve meat loaf warm or cover and refrigerate to serve cold.
